What is Vision Training & Eye Exercise?

Vision Training & Eye Exercise is a gamified therapy app for binocular vision conditions, available on iOS, Android, and Meta Quest.

Users hire this app to perform repetitive, clinically-backed eye exercises at home, replacing expensive in-person therapy sessions with an adaptive, gamified routine.

What Are The Key Features?

Gamified Vision ExercisesDifferentiator

28+ interactive games designed to train visual skills like convergence, divergence, and depth perception

Personalized Daily WorkoutsDifferentiator

Workouts automatically adjust difficulty based on user performance metrics

Professional Analytics DashboardDifferentiator

Performance tracking and user management tools for clinical or home-based monitoring

The outtake for Vision Training & Eye Exercise

Strengths to defend, gaps to attack

Core Strengths

  • Adaptive difficulty mimics clinical progression
  • Cross-platform Meta Quest support expands therapy funnel
  • Professional analytics provide B2B utility for clinics

Critical Frictions

  • Aggressive ad frequency disrupts therapy sessions
  • Video loading errors block core content
  • High-cost paywalls for medical recovery tools

Growth Levers

  • Untapped B2B partnerships with vision clinics
  • Tablet-optimized interfaces for improved ergonomics

Market Threats

  • Established wellness apps with higher brand authority
  • Technical instability driving users to clinical-only alternatives
  • EU data-minimization tightening on health-related apps
